You are cordially invited to the Annual Lecture of the UCL Centre for Transnational History.

The speaker will be Patricia Clavin, Fellow of Jesus College and Professor of International History at the University of Oxford.

Her lecture will be entitled Ropes around the necks of our debtors': Europe and the Transnational History of Development, 1920-1970.
